Frankfurt Airport introduces premium ‘Home to Gate’ departure service

Frankfurt Airport is offering its departing travellers a new premium “˜Home to Gate’ service, available for all airlines and destinations.

The service, which includes limousine transfer and a service guide, aims to take the stress out of the departure procedure and make it easier and more convenient for travellers to fly from Frankfurt Airport.

“There’s no longer any need for you to look for a parking space, haul suitcases, or wait in line at the check-in counter,” the airport stated. “You’re picked up at your home and taken all the way to your departure gate. You can take advantage of the “˜Home to Gate’ service no matter which airline or class you’ve booked or which destination you’re heading for.”

The airport outlined the process: “The driver is at the agreed-on meeting point right on time. You and your travelling companions are picked up in a Mercedes S-Class, VW Phaeton, or BMW 7 Series car or Mercedes van and chauffeured to the airport. Once there, a service guide takes care of your luggage and handles check-in while you relax over a free drink in a nearby bistro.

“The guide then returns with your boarding passes and escorts you straight through a special separate security checkpoint, bypassing the lines. On the apron in front of the terminal, another car waits to take you straight to your departure gate,” it added.

Travellers can book the “˜Home to Gate’ service for up to four persons leaving on the same flight. The per-person price of the service depends on the proximity to the airport: up to 20 km €229; up to 40 km €249 and up to 80 km €299.

The service can be booked online at www.frankfurt-airport.com up to 48 hours before departure, with payment by credit card after arrival at the airport. The price includes two checked bags and carry-on luggage.

According to Frankfurt Airport, the service is part of its ongoing “˜Great to have you here!’ programme aimed at enhancing the experience of passengers and visitors.
